Marisa Gabriella Petrocelli-Jackson, lovingly known as “Titi”,74, of the Bronx, New York passed away on Friday, October 24, 2025 after a brief illness. Marisa was born on March 20, 1951 in Rome, Italy to the late John Petrocelli Sr. and Nenetta Napolitano. The Petrocelli Family immigrated to Brooklyn, New York in the 1950’s where she spent the majority of her life before moving to Jackson Heights, Queens in the 1970’s and eventually to the Bronx in 2009 where she spent the rest of her life.

She attended St. Brendan’s Catholic school where she received her high school diploma in 1968. Marisa was a proud graduate of NYU University where she received her master’s degree in education in 1972. A hard worker, she began her employment with the NYC Dept of Education as a paraprofessional in the Bronx in 1979 and then as a teacher and literacy coach at PS 85, where she worked for more than 35 years before retiring in 2013. These roles exemplified her deep commitment to helping others and bettering their education. In a relationship that spanned over 30years, Marisa married the Late Tommy Jackson on January 2, 2004.

Marisa Petrocelli was a one-of-a-kind person who filled everyone’s heart with so much love and warmth. Marisa loved her family and friends and her door and heart were open to all that needed her. She was committed to living her life to the fullest and was a true warrior and fought hard until the end. She was an amazing wife, daughter, sister, aunt and friend and would help anyone at the drop of a hat.

She loved watching tv shows and movies such as Big Bang Theory and Grey’s Anatomy, West Side Storyand Once Upon a Time in Hollywood . She was a fan of iconic artists such as The Beatles, Bruce Springsteen and The Rolling Stones. She also loved traveling to Europe and the Caribbean. She will truly be missed for the great laughs and times that she shared with her friends, family and co-workers throughout her years.
